Common Problems: PORSCHE macan
Known issues reported by owners and MOT testers.
- Timing Cover Oil Leak (V6)(Moderate)
Aluminium bolts on the timing cover snap, causing oil to seep. Can be fixed with steel bolts or a full engine-out reseal.
- Transfer Case Judder(Serious)
Wear in the transfer box causes a shuddering sensation. A very common Macan complaint.
- Front Suspension Arm Wear(Moderate)
The front lower control arms and coffin arms wear prematurely, especially on cars with larger 20-21 inch wheels. Causes clunking over bumps.
